The Quest for True Love in 'Media Naranja'

Grupo 5's song "Media Naranja" is a vibrant exploration of love's complexities, set against the backdrop of lively Peruvian cumbia rhythms. The song delves into the intricacies of romantic relationships, emphasizing the idea that true love requires complete devotion. The lyrics suggest that when one truly loves, they give themselves entirely, yet there's always a risk of betrayal, as hinted by the phrase "te sacaran la vuelta," which means being cheated on.

The song also touches on the notion that love should be a partnership between two people, free from external interference. The mention of "la suegra" (the mother-in-law) and "la amiga" (the friend) highlights the common cultural trope of meddling third parties in relationships. This reflects a universal theme where external influences can complicate romantic bonds. The song humorously suggests that these individuals "no tienen vida propia," or have no life of their own, thus interfering in others' affairs.

Furthermore, "Media Naranja" explores the idea that love is unpredictable and sometimes unreciprocated, yet there's always hope of finding one's perfect match, or "media naranja." The song acknowledges the challenges of unrequited love but maintains an optimistic tone, encouraging listeners to follow their hearts. The lyrics also playfully reference various love-related superstitions and practices, such as "brujería" (witchcraft) and "hechicería" (sorcery), adding a cultural layer to the narrative. Ultimately, Grupo 5's song is a celebration of love's trials and triumphs, wrapped in the energetic and infectious sound of cumbia music.
